Croatia's exports in first eleven months of 2021 up by 27 pct, imports by 23 pct

The value of Croatian exports of goods in the first eleven months of 2021 amounted to €17.1 billion, a year-on-year increase of 26.5 percent. At the same time, imports grew by 23 percent to €25.7 billion, state agency Hina said, citing data released by the state statistics bureau.
The foreign trade deficit thus totaled close to €8.55 billion. Exports to EU member countries in the first eleven months totaled €11.8 billion or 28.2 percent more than in the same period of 2020 while imports from those countries grew by 18.5 percent to €19.67 billion.
Exports to non-EU countries in the first 11 months increased by 22.8 percent to €5.3 billion and imports from them by 40.4 percent to €6 billion.
